We are seeking an experienced Automation Engineer to join our team. This role is intended for an engineer with real-world field and commissioning experience, not an entry-level or quality-control-focused position. The ideal candidate is technically strong, professional, and comfortable leading automation efforts in high-pressure commissioning environments.
This position supports projects nationwide and requires travel within the continental United States for on-site commissioning activities.
- Develop, program, and commission PLC and HMI systems in accordance with project specifications
- Lead and support on-site startup and commissioning activities, typically lasting 30 days or less
- Perform loop checks, point-to-point testing, and verification of PLC I/O
- Troubleshoot live automation systems and resolve issues efficiently and safely
- Develop and maintain I/O lists, cause and effect diagrams, and control narratives
- Produce redline documentation and support creation of as-built drawings
- Develop engineering sketches and provide direction to field electricians
- Read and interpret electrical schematics and P&IDs
- Apply knowledge of three-phase power systems, including 480V, 5kV, and 15kV class systems (controls interface)
- Adhere to applicable industry codes and standards, including NFPA 70, IEEE, and API
- Support instrumentation, VFD commissioning, and industrial networking as required
